Capper Foundation is a Kansas-based provider within the hospitals and health care sector that focuses on services for infants, children, teens, and adults with disabilities. Its offerings include pediatric therapy, adult day services, adult residential services, and job employment services, alongside training and development for families and professionals to support independence and development. The organization serves individuals with disabilities and aims to help them thrive by offering a range of supports that address medical, developmental, and social needs, positioning itself as a comprehensive community resource in Topeka, Kansas. The foundation operates from Topeka and has grown to serve a regional community through its diversified programs, with leadership changes in recent years and collaborations that expand its reach, such as partnerships and community-oriented initiatives.
